English: The map describes the boundaries of the Decapolis in the 1st century A.D. The boundary lines were drawn on the basis of recognized research with the latest knowledge and according to existing topographical conditions. At the same time, border and Pashalik courses that still exist today were included. In addition to the cities of the Decapolis, those of Pliny are also listed in the Hist. nat. mentioned area districts / realms between the cities included. Ancient landscape names given in grey complement the map.
